Super bright high intensity RED LED (T1 3/4) have smaller light emitting viewing angle cones. These RED LEDs could be a 15 degree VA cone. A 15 degree cone delivers higher intensity than a 30 degree cone. Mine look the same intensity when viewed 3ft behind my bike.
I think it's possible that the tailights are not equally tilted vertically causing the viewing angle to be out of range when you are following behind. Don't rule out a horizontal misalignment as well.
I want to initially check BDB2's taillight housings using a tilt angle gauge on the housing face after the bike is plum in the lift.
If the housings are identical then I will look at the circuit board mounting.
Easiest thing to do is adjust the taillight tilt until they seem the same intensity while viewed from 50ft back.
If it's not the above causing the difference then it's probably a current/voltage drop through the harness to the one side.
